Sosialisasi dan Edukasi Pendidikan Anti Kekerasan Seksual bagi Tenaga Pendidik SDIT Bina Cendekia Depok Jawa Barat

Sexual violence against children remains a serious issue in Indonesia. Therefore, providing early education on the prevention of sexual violence is crucial to protect children from potential harm. This community service activity was conducted on Thursday, April 24, 2025, at SDIT Bina Cendekia Depok, aiming to enhance teachers’ understanding of the importance of anti-sexual violence education and to offer effective teaching strategies for delivering the material to students. The methods employed included socialization, interactive discussions, and case simulations. The results showed an increase in teachers' awareness in identifying signs of sexual violence, preventive measures, and appropriate communication techniques for conveying the topic to students. Through this training, teachers are expected to become agents of change in creating a safe and child-friendly school environment.
